-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
课题4单片机中断与定时功能的
表4-3最大计数值选择表 返回 图4-8方式1的内部结构图 返回 图4-10方式2的内部结构图 返回 图4-11方式3的内部结构图 返回 表4-4 LED资源分配表 返回 图4-14交通灯控制程序 返回 课题4单片机中断与定时功能的应用 [任务4. 1]利用按键产生外部中断控制信号灯亮灭 [任务4. 2]方波信号发生器的设计 [任务4. 3]交通信号灯设计和调试 小结 思考题 [任务4. 1]利用按键产生外部中断控制信号灯亮灭 4.1.1外部中断的使用实训 1.问题的引出 2.操作演示或跟着做 3.观察现象 4.分析 下一页 返回 [任务4. 1]利用按键产生外部中断控制信号灯亮灭 4.1.2什么是中断 1.中断的概念 中断是CPU在执行现行程序过程中,发生随机事件或特殊请求,使CPU中止现行程序的执行,转去执行随机事件或特殊请求的处理程序,待处理完毕后,在返回被中止的程序继续执行的过程。 2.几个相关术语 中断源 中断请求信号 上一页 下一页 返回 [任务4. 1]利用按键产生外部中断控制信号灯亮灭 中断断点 中断返回 中断响应 中断服务程序 4.1.3中断的作用与基本功能 1.中断的作用 (1)分时操作 (2)实时处理 (3)故障处理 上一页 下一页 返回 [任务4. 1]利用按键产生外部中断控制信号灯亮灭 2.中断源 引起中断的事件称为中断源。计算机的中断源通常有以下几种: (1)一般输入/输出设备 (2)实时时钟或计数信号 (3)故障源 (4)为调试程序而设置的中断源 3.中断系统的基本功能 (1)识别中断源 (2)实现中断及返回 (3)实现优先权排队 (4)高级中断源能中断低级中断处理 上一页 下一页 返回 [任务4. 1]利用按键产生外部中断控制信号灯亮灭 4. 1. 4 MCS-51单片机中断系统的组成 1. MCS-51系列单片机中的中断源 8051单片机有5个中断源,分别是INTO , NIT1 , TO , T1和串行口。 2.中断请求标志 (1)定时器/计数器控制寄存器TCON (88H) (2)串行口控制寄存器SCON (98H) 3.中断允许控制寄存器IE (A8H) 4.中断源优先级控制寄存器IP (B8H) 上一页 下一页 返回 [任务4. 1]利用按键产生外部中断控制信号灯亮灭 4.1.5中断响应 1.响应条件 CPU响应中断的条件有: ①有中断源发出中断请求。 ②中断总允许位EA=1,即CPU开中断 ③中请中断的中断源的中断允许位为1 满足以上条件,CPU响应中断;如果中断受阻,CPU不会响应中断. 上一页 下一页 返回 [任务4. 1]利用按键产生外部中断控制信号灯亮灭 2.响应过程 单片机一旦响应中断,首先置位响应的优先级触发器,然后执行一个硬件子程序调用,把断点地址压入堆栈保护,然后将对应的中断入口地址装入程序计数器PC,使程序转向该中断入口地址,以执行中断服务程序。 3.中断处理 CPU响应中断结束后即转至中断服务程序的入口。从中断服务程序的第一条指令开始到返回指令为止,这个过程称为中断处理或称中断服务。 上一页 下一页 返回 [任务4. 1]利用按键产生外部中断控制信号灯亮灭 4.中断返回 中断处理程序的最后一条指令是中断返回指令RETI。 4. 1. 6 MCS-51单片机中断系统应用 1.中断系统的初始化 包括以下三个部分: (1)开中断 (2)确定优先权 (3)确定外部中断触发方式 上一页 下一页 返回 [任务4. 1]利用按键产生外部中断控制信号灯亮灭 2.外部中断举例和实训 (1)硬件原理图 本例硬件可由课题2制作的最小系统和信号灯电路构成,硬件原理图如4-2所示。 (2)流程图 如图4-3所示。 上一页 下一页 返回 [任务4. 1]利用按键产生外部中断控制信号灯亮灭 (3)程序 (4)操作练习 ①通过仿真软件仿真调试。 ②在自制的实验板上调试。 上一页 返回 [任务4. 2]方波信号发生器的设计 4. 2.1方波信号发生器 1.问题的引出 要求用MCS-51单片机做信号发生器,产生周期为1 m*即频率为1 kHz的方波信号。 2.操作演示或跟着做 ①我们在课题2制作的单片机最小系统板上,将信号灯电路板接到单片机的P1口,将编好的程序写人单片机中,接通电源 ②只用单片机最小系统板,将编好的程序(后面例题具体分析)写人单片机中,接通电源 ③也可用仿真软件仿真 下一页 返回 [任务4. 2]方波信号发生器的设计 3.观察现象 ①可观察到接Pl. 1引脚的信号灯亮灭闪烁。 ②用示波器从MCS-51单片机的Pl. 1引脚可观察到1 kHz的方波信号 4.分析 4. 2. 2单片机定时器/计数器结构 在实时控制系统中,经常需要有实时时钟
您可能关注的文档
最近下载
- 2025呼和浩特粮油收储有限公司招聘18名工作人员笔试备考题库及答案解析.docx VIP
- 一种含电极的智能指环、灌胶治具及其封装工艺.pdf VIP
- The Wonderful Wizard of Oz-绿野仙踪(带动画) 课件.pdf VIP
- 2025至2030中国老年照护行业市场发展分析及竞争格局与投资发展报告.docx
- 2010年考研英语真题及解析.pdf VIP
- 浙江省强基联盟2024-2025学年高一上学期10月联考生物试卷.docx VIP
- 第一章 应急管理导论-2.ppt VIP
- 大连理工工程力学课件0.pdf VIP
- 大行距造林中杨树营养面积与大行距经济效益的研究.docx VIP
- 2025学宪法讲宪法知识竞赛题库及参考答案.pptx
文档评论(0)